Research Abstract |
There are many kind of building systems for preservation, we set limits to subject of our study to dismantle and reconstruct for repair in modem buildings. At first we surveyed conditions of preservation of modem buildings in Nagasaki, Kobe and Yokohama where are many modem buildings are remained in high density. From the result of this surveys, we got hold that for buildings which were built before Edo period, building systems to preserve are formulated a little, but for buildings which were built after Meiji period, building systems to preserve are individual and on the spur of the moment. And next we surveyed the reason why some modem buildings in Tochigi prefecture were demolished and the other were preserved. Then we gathered reports on modem buildings across the nation which are preserved by removing and reconstruction and we indicated a flow-chart of flow of actions of removing and reconstruction for preservation by the result of analysis 17 reports which have remarkable characteristics. The changes of members that compose buildings were indicated clearly by symbolization of the members. The process for work was divided into 6 steps, and common elements of each work were extracted. And a matrix of 6 process of work and the elements of each work was made. Symbolization and this matrix show a framework that is able to examine precise building system for preservation by dismantlement and reconstruction work.
